          In the book of Lamentations, Jeremiah mourns the destruction of Jerusalem and of his people. He had warned them, pleaded with them but they had refused to listen. What he had declared from God finally came to pass. Yet God, the covenant-keeping God that He is, did not put a complete end to this nation. He saved a remnant who would come to repentance and prosper in enemy territory. He was still determined to keep His promise to Abraham and this people!
          Like I said, God is a covenant-keeping God. He always keeps His end of the bargain even when we don't. He simply finds a way to bring what He has promised to pass. God will try and try with us. It only ends when we refuse to relent and death brings an end to us. Once we are alive there is always hope.
          But that's one of the great things about serving our God, He doesn't give up as easily and as quickly as we do. He will try, He will work with us to bring about change. That's what He did with Israel. He sent prophet after prophet to speak to them, to warn them, to plead with them. He knew that their sinful actions would bring about their own destruction and He was trying to spare them the heartache, the heartbreak and not to mention the loss of life. God sees around corners, we can't. Our vision, our understanding is limited and this is where He tries to help us out. Unfortunately, we think we know everything and we foolishly destroy ourselves. 
          It's about absolute surrender, absolute trust that God knows and sees what we don't and can't and that He allows it to be like this so we can learn to trust Him and rely on Him. But we miss it and end up messing up and missing out many times.
          I mentioned in a previous post that I had backslidden many years ago. I thought I was happy but I was not and I certainly wasn't free. I was depressed and initially didn't know why but afterwards realised it was because I had moved away from God. I tried different things to be happy and resisted God's efforts to bring me back to Him. Still I was unhappy. When I finally surrendered to Him I discovered a joy that was beyond just plain happiness. I had never experienced this before. I was also finally free . . . because I surrendered to God.
​          Won't you surrender to Him today? Trust Him, allow Him to guide you because He does see and know all. It's not about giving up your freedom but rather gaining it. When we go our own way, we put ourselves in bondage and are miserable. Resisting Him would bring sure destruction and a life without hope; surrendering to Him, a life of joy, peace and freedom like you've never experienced before. It's not a life without challenges but one with an assurance that the God who is able to deliver and protect is on your side. You will have your own personal warrior fighting for you every time!
